A strong brand guide will typically include: • Proper and improper logo usage. • Clear space and scaling rules. • Approved background applications. • Brand-approved language and messaging examples. • Guidelines for internal vs. external communications. This ensures your brand always looks and sounds the way it was intended — professional, polished and on point. SAVE TIME, REDUCE CONFUSION AND INCREASE EFFICIENCY When designers, marketers, vendors or team members need your logo or brand assets, they shouldn’t have to ask a dozen questions. A brand guide centralizes all brand elements in one place, eliminating confusion and ensuring quick, consistent execution across platforms. Whether you’re launching a campaign, producing merchandise or onboarding a new hire, brand standards reduce guesswork and create efficiency. ENABLE SCALABLE AND SUSTAINABLE GROWTH As your business expands into new markets or channels, more people will represent your brand across more platforms. Without clearly defined brand standards, every touchpoint becomes a risk for inconsistency. A logo and brand guide enables growth by ensuring that your visual and verbal identity stays consistent, no matter who’s creating the content or where it’s being used. This is particularly important for: • Franchise or multi-location businesses. • Companies using external agencies or freelancers. • National brands entering new regions or industries. ELEVATE PROFESSIONALISM AND BRAND EQUITY A cohesive, polished brand experience communicates professionalism and builds brand equity over time. Brand standards signal to your internal team and external partners that your brand is a strategic asset, not just a design choice. It also helps align internal culture with external messaging. Everyone in your organization — from marketing to HR — can speak in the same voice and represent the brand accurately. A strong logo is only as powerful as its consistent application. Developing a comprehensive logo brand guide and clearly defined brand standards creates the foundation for a scalable, recognizable and trustworthy brand. Whether you’re building your brand for the first time or looking to refresh and formalize it, investing in brand standards will pay off in clarity, credibility and long-term value.
